This 2-Pack of ecoEfficiency EN-EL14, EN-EL14A lithium-ion batteries is designed for Nikon DSLR cameras, providing a reliable and high-capacity power source. With a voltage of 7.4V and a capacity of 1030mAh, these batteries ensure optimal performance for extended photo and video sessions. Compatible with multiple Nikon models, they are lightweight, rechargeable, and eco-friendly, making them the perfect companion for photographers on the move.
Item Dimensions | 2 x 1 x 0.5 inches |
Item Weight | 0.2 Pounds |
Battery Weight | 29 Grams |
Unit Count | 2 Count |
Battery Cell Type | Lithium Ion |
Recommended Uses For Product | Camera |
Reusability | Rechargeable |
Battery Capacity | 1030 Milliampere Hour (mAh) |
Voltage | 7.4 Volts |

A little less capacity than the factory battery, but quite adequate as a backup or additional supply
These batteries are very low cost, and appear to be well made. They perform very nicely in the D5600 camera, and charge with no problems in the Nikon factory charger. If you read the specs carefully, they are a bit lower capacity than the factory supplied battery (at least for the D5600, but not sure about other models.) I have not found this to be a problem, because I now have three batteries and never have a shooting session that takes more than one. So plenty of juice to meet my needs, at a very reasonable price.

Half-life at best
These batteries work on my D5100. But, I take photographs over a frequently very, very, very long day, and while the batteries that originally came with my D5100 usually suffice - I often find myself in need of that extra hour or so of battery life. So, with that regard - these batteries are fine...as they last about an hour...give or take 20 minutes. ...and it's the take 20 that bothers me. I've actually found myself starting with one of these batteries, just to get it used up and then switching back to my original (read dependable) batteries...leaving the second battery from the pack as a battery of last resort. By my normal shoot time - these last about 1/3 to 1/4 the time as my original batteries - so while they are a decent quality - I'd not purchase again and am still looking for a solid replacement/supplement for my original batteries (at which time I'll probably shelve these).
